nrf52 high data rate

gkovelman_tap gravatar image

asked 2017-07-17 13:01:45 +0100

Hi, Can the nRF52832 support higher data rates:

  • UART TX baud rate of more than 1Mbps, such as 3 Mbps without bitbanging.
  • TWI of 1MHz

any trick to get them working so?

Thanks.

edit retag flag offensive close delete report spam

Comments

1

No and No.

endnode ( 2017-07-17 13:05:43 +0100 )editconvert to answer

Cool. 10Chars

gkovelman_tap ( 2017-07-17 13:09:48 +0100 )editconvert to answer

To make it longer: the only trick which seems to be possible is to go with TWIM->FREQUENCY and UARTE->BAUDRATE registers outside of their spec. The values are not "locked" in the controller (at least according to specification here and here) however it's very unlikely that they would be stable so much out of tested and design range. Even if you get lucky on one of 5/10/100 chips to get it significantly higher then 400kHz/1MHz you won't be able to keep this across large batch of chips. There were similar questions on this forum, see what Nordic team says...

endnode ( 2017-07-17 13:17:49 +0100 )editconvert to answer
2

The 1 MHz I²C hardware uses faster transmitters with current souces. These are not present in NRF5x chips.

Turbo J ( 2017-07-17 14:08:15 +0100 )editconvert to answer
2

For UART, see: this answer here

Turbo J ( 2017-07-17 14:19:29 +0100 )editconvert to answer

Sounds like TX at 2/4/8 Mbps is possible. I'll also play with the TWI frequency. I'll see what's the actual limit.

gkovelman_tap ( 2017-07-17 15:12:45 +0100 )editconvert to answer